Understanding Foot Dysfunction and Its Impact

When the feet are misaligned, imbalanced, or structurally weak, they can’t properly absorb shock, support your body weight, or facilitate efficient movement. Common signs of poor foot function include:

Arch collapse or excessive flat-footedness

Instability when walking or running

Pain in the heels, arches, toes, or ankles

Overuse of surrounding joints (knees, hips, back)

Decreased balance or increased risk of falling

Uneven weight distribution or pressure points

These symptoms often stem from underlying mechanical issues, such as overpronation, rigid arches, poor toe mechanics, or muscle imbalances. Left untreated, these problems can worsen over time and lead to chronic pain or injury.

How Custom Orthotics Work

Custom orthotics are specially made devices inserted into your footwear. Unlike store-bought insoles, which offer generic support, custom orthotics are molded based on a precise evaluation of your foot structure, gait, and overall biomechanics. The goal is not just to cushion the foot but to correct its mechanics, enhance alignment, and improve overall function.

Key Benefits of Custom Orthotics for Foot Function

1. Enhanced Structural Support:

Custom orthotics reinforce the natural arch of your foot, preventing excessive flattening or inward rolling. This keeps your foot stable and better aligned during movement.

2. Improved Weight Distribution:

Orthotics redistribute pressure more evenly across the foot, reducing the risk of calluses, ulcers, or pressure sores, especially in people who stand or walk for long hours.

3. Reduced Muscle Strain:

By correcting alignment, orthotics decrease the load on overworked muscles. This allows smaller foot muscles to work more efficiently and relieves larger muscles (like the calves or hamstrings) from compensating.

4. Increased Range of Motion:

Improved foot mechanics allow for smoother transitions through each phase of gait—heel strike, midstance, and toe-off—making your stride more fluid and natural.

5. Enhanced Shock Absorption:

Orthotics help absorb and dissipate the forces created with each step, reducing joint stress and minimizing wear on cartilage and tendons.

Custom Orthotics for Common Foot Conditions

Custom orthotics are highly beneficial for individuals with:

Plantar fasciitis

Flat feet or high arches

Bunions or hammertoes

Achilles tendinitis

Metatarsalgia (ball-of-foot pain)

Neuromas

Diabetic foot complications

Post-surgery rehabilitation

In all these cases, orthotics work by correcting faulty mechanics and allowing the foot to function as naturally and efficiently as possible.

Orthotics and Improved Mobility

Mobility isn’t just about range of motion—it’s about how comfortably and confidently you can move through space. Pain, stiffness, or instability can significantly hinder your ability to walk, climb stairs, or even stand for extended periods.

With proper orthotic support, mobility improves in several ways:

Better balance and stability, reducing fall risk

Improved walking cadence and stride length

Less fatigue after physical activity

Faster recovery after injury or physical stress

Restored natural movement patterns

When to Consider Custom Orthotics

You don’t need to wait for severe symptoms to seek orthotic help. Consider custom orthotics if you:

Experience frequent foot or lower limb pain

Notice wear patterns on your shoes suggesting uneven gait

Feel unstable or off-balance when walking

Are recovering from a foot injury or surgery

Have been diagnosed with a structural foot issue

Want to enhance mobility as you age

Orthotics are particularly beneficial for people with physically demanding jobs, athletes, older adults, or anyone who wants to move more comfortably in daily life.
